The Culinary Mosaic: Beyond Curry If there is one language every Indian speaks fluently, it is food. However, "Indian food" is a misnomer in the global lexicon; there is no single Indian cuisine. 1. Regional Diversities To write about Indian lifestyle is to write about diversity. The heavy, wheat-based curries of Punjab contrast sharply with the light, rice-and-coconut-heavy fare of Kerala. The fermentation culture of the Northeast, with its bamboo shoots and soybeans, shares little DNA with the rich Mughlai cuisine of Lucknow. Lifestyle content creators are increasingly focusing on micro-regional cuisines , bringing forgotten recipes from grandmothers’ kitchens to Instagram reels. This shift represents a move away from "Curry" to hyper-local stories—like the art of making a perfect Sadya or the winter delicacies of Kashmir, Harissa . 2. Food as Ritual In India, food is never just sustenance; it is medicine ( Ayurveda ), it is offering ( Prasad ), and it is love. The concept of Atithi Devo Bhava (The guest is equivalent to God) dictates that a guest must never leave a home hungry. This hospitality is a cornerstone of the Indian lifestyle, creating a culture of abundance and sharing that is vividly captured in food blogs and travel vlogs. The Warp and Weft: Fashion and Textiles Indian fashion is currently undergoing a renaissance, moving away from the blind aping of Western trends toward a celebration of indigenous roots. 1. Handloom and Sustainability Long before "sustainable fashion" became a global buzzword, India was practicing it. The Khadi movement championed by Mahatma Gandhi is seeing a resurgence among the youth. Content creators are now highlighting the arduous process behind a Banarasi silk saree or the intricate weave of a Kanjeevaram. The modern Indian lifestyle involves conscious consumerism—wearing fabrics that support local artisans and carry centuries of craftsmanship. 2. The Fusion Revolution Today's Indian lifestyle is best symbolized by the "Indo-Western" aesthetic. It is common to see a young professional in Bangalore wearing a Kurta with jeans, or sneakers paired with a Sherwani at a wedding. Fashion bloggers are championing this fluidity, proving that traditional wear is not "costume" but a daily expression of identity. The Saree , once considered too formal for the workplace, is being draped in novel ways—over pants or with belts—making it relevant for the 21st-century woman. Festivals: The Heartbeat of the Year India is often described as the land of festivals. The sheer frequency of celebrations creates a lifestyle that is punctuated by joy, color, and community. 1. Diwali and The Festival of Lights Diwali, the festival of lights, is perhaps the most globally recognized Indian event. But within the country, the lifestyle content surrounding it is immense—from the cleaning and renovation of homes to the explosion of fireworks and the exchange of gifts. It represents a reset button for the year, a time for financial introspection and family bonding. 2. Holi and The Colors of Unity Holi, the festival of colors, breaks down social barriers. Content around Holi focuses on the temporary suspension of rules—where strangers become friends under a cloud of colored powder. It captures the sheer exuberance of the Indian spirit, a reminder that life, despite its hardships, is meant to be celebrated.
